7 It is further submitted that it is a normal practice that the trial Courts are insisting for moving an application for plea bargaining / plead guilty on the assurance to let off the accused lightly by paying the fine only. In the present case as well the accused had been under the impression that he was moving the application for plea bargaining when he moved his application for plea guilty and the Ld. MM as well assuming it to be a case of plea bargaining had let off the accused by imposing a fine of Rs.5,000/-. It is submitted that the plea of guilt entered into by the accused was under the mistaken impression of being let off lightly as is being done regularly by the Courts when the accused enters into plea bargain. To support his assertions, the Ld. counsel has placed on record the copies of the orders of various MMs, who under the scheme of plea bargain have been letting off the accused persons under the similar provisions of Copyright Act by simplicitor imposition of nominal fine.
